On November 29, 2003 at 14:22:08, George Sobala wrote: >How quickly does your engine find the queen sac? >Rebel 12 prefers it instantly. > >This position came up in a tournament game on ICC yesterday, Rebel 12 v (I >think) Fritz 8 with a human operator, 10 6 time control. > >[D] rnr3k1/1b1nbppp/pq2p3/1p1pN3/3P1P2/4P1P1/PPQBN1BP/2R2RK1 w - - 4 1 > there is a small error in the FEN string, because you can't have 4 half moves (without a capturing or a pawn move) in move 1. Ok it's not very important, because the 50 moves rule is far away, but perhaps some GUIs or engines will have problems with the wrong FEN string.
